Frequently asked questions about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ham

What is the rental price in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ham?

The current average rental price in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ham is £417 per month. Mouseprice is currently listing 2 properties to rent in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ham.

What schools are there in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ham?

Nearby schools in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ham include St Michael's C of E Primary School,

What stations are there in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ham?

Nearby stations in Bishop Middleham, Ferryhill, Durham include Newton Aycliffe Station, Heighington Station, Shildon Station, Bishop Auckland Station, Durham Station.
